Amentum is seeking a talented and experienced Junior Database Administrator to support the Program Executive Office, Submarines (PEO Submarines), to perform R&D, technology maturation and insertion, analysis, testing, and systems engineering to assess and enhance microelectronics component technologies. This shall include updating and enhancing related microelectronics T&E facilities and laboratories; related capabilities associated with the Navy's FBM system and SWS; and DoD strategic weapons platforms employing advanced and critical microelectronics technologies. The goal is to modify and upgrade legacy microelectronics T&E facilities and technologies as well as develop and integrate the next generation of advanced laboratories, laboratory technology systems, test facilities, and other facilities to include design, development, modification, and stand-up requirements.

Responsibilities:
- The Database Management/Administrator I shall perform one or more of the following tasks in support of computer database administration: architects, designs, oversee the development of, or administers computerized databases, installs the applicable databases onto the appropriate computer operating systems, creates databases, configure databases (for a data warehousing application), use import utilities to install databases.
- Includes creation of Indexes, Clusters, Snapshots, Views, and other database objects, as well as, management of Rollback Segments, Data File Size, and all the other aspects related to the performance tuning of databases.
- Shall write code for update queries, update data dictionaries as new fields are added to the database and maintain a data correction log.
- Shall create and maintain data correction logs that identify the date the correction that was performed, tables and fields effected, submission effected, error code effected, and other pertinent metadata.
- Shall expand and update the data dictionary for the database and any related applications.

Required Skills and Qualifications:
- Requires a HS diploma (BA/BS preferred); at least 2 years of experience in the field or in a related area
- Familiarity with database management and data pipelines and integration in a cloud environment.
Experience executing data import/export processes and developing customized data flows supporting cloud-based database solutions. - Experience managing data in support of a cloud migration.
Ability to work independently. - Must have excellent oral and written communication skills.
Be familiar with Microsoft Office Suite 365. - Able to efficiently use the latest reporting, analysis, and communication technology.
- Must have an Active Secret US Government Clearance. Note: US Citizenship is required to obtain a Secret Clearance.
